About The Company
At Bayshore, we believe in creating special moments for our clients each and every day, whether at the bedside, on the phone or in the clinic. These moments touch the lives of our clients and our employees, and they guide the way we run our business. These moments inspire, change and encourage us. They are what we call the Bayshore difference. Bayshore HealthCare is one of the country’s leading providers of home and community health care services and is a Canadian-owned company. With over 100 locations across the country, including home care offices, pharmacies and infusion clinics, Bayshore has more than 13,000 staff members and provides care to over 350,000 clients. We are dedicated to enhancing the quality of life, dignity and independence of all Canadians, by providing customized care plans and solutions that allow clients to remain in the comfort of their own home. About the Role

JOB SUMMARY

The Shift Manager, Warehouse Operations is responsible for leading daytoday operational performance across all lines of business within the BSRx Fulfillment Facility, including but not limited to, OHAH, Specialty, DEX, HelioMed, and Shipping & Receiving. Reporting to the Manager, Warehouse Operations, this role provides handson leadership to ensure safe, efficient, and compliant execution of warehouse activities across assigned shifts.

The Shift Manager partners closely with Inventory Managers, the Logistics Manager, Pharmacy partners—including Bayshore Compounding Services—and other crossfunctional stakeholders to maintain operational flow, resolve issues, and support service excellence. The role also contributes to strategic initiatives, capacity planning, workflow optimization, and continuous improvement efforts led by the Manager, Warehouse Operations.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Operational Leadership

·       Lead and manage all warehouse activities across assigned shifts, ensuring efficient execution of receiving, shipping, inventory movement, and fulfillment tasks.

·       Oversee daily operations across all BSRx business lines, ensuring service levels and productivity targets are met.

·       Provide clear direction to shift teams, ensuring alignment with operational priorities and performance expectations.

·       Support workflow optimization, resource allocation, and capacity planning in collaboration with the Manager, Warehouse Operations.

·       Own end‑to‑end accountability for shift performance across all business lines, including service levels, throughput, backlog recovery, and timely resolution of operational gaps.

·       Exercise real‑time decision‑making authority during the shift to re‑prioritize work, reallocate labour, adjust workflows, and redirect resources to protect service, quality, and safety outcomes.

·       Monitor and manage shift‑level KPIs (e.g., productivity, errors, backlog, labour efficiency), taking immediate corrective action and escalating material risks with recommended solutions.

·       Ensure effective shift‑to‑shift handover by documenting outstanding issues, risks, and priorities, and communicating clearly with incoming shifts and leadership to maintain operational continuity.

·       Act as the primary escalation point during the shift for operational, quality, safety, inventory, and service delivery issues, ensuring timely resolution or structured handoff.

·       Enforce quality, safety, and compliance standards by exercising stop‑work authority and escalating immediately when risks to product integrity, regulatory compliance, or employee safety are identified.

·       Maintain shift‑level accountability for inventory integrity by ensuring accurate system transactions, controlled movements, and adherence to inventory management processes.

·       Drive execution and adoption of new SOPs, workflow changes, and system updates on shift, addressing execution gaps and reinforcing compliance through coaching and oversight.
